Get creative with Colour Club London

Join artist Eloisa Henderson-Figueroa for a creative play session in the Turbine Hall. Over time we start to lose the ability to play and create just for fun and can put too much pressure on ourselves to make something 'perfect'. This idea can stop us from creating and Eloisa wants to change that narrative by encouraging playful spaces for people to enjoy making art. The focus of this workshop is to not overthink, and just do what comes naturally by playing with the materials. You’ll use varied mediums including stickers, tapes, and collage to create your own playful artwork inspired by ºÚÁÏÉç's collection.

Listen to live music on the Level 1 Bridge

Come to the Level 1 Bridge to enjoy live music alongside Louise Bourgeois’ giant spider sculpture. Maman welcomed visitors to ºÚÁÏÉç when it opened in 2000 and has now returned for a limited time to celebrate ºÚÁÏÉç’s 25th anniversary. Music sets will be taking place throughout the night and a pop-up bar will be open late.

All ºÚÁÏÉç entrances are step-free. You can enter via the Turbine Hall and into the Natalie Bell Building on Holland Street, or into the Blavatnik Building on Sumner street.

There are lifts to every floor of the Blavatnik and Natalie Bell buildings. Alternatively you can take the stairs.

  • Fully accessible toilets are located on every floor on the concourses.
  • A quiet room is available to use in the Natalie Bell Building on Level 4.
  • Ear defenders can be borrowed from the Ticket desks.
